-#include "acconfig.h"
-
-// Use the newer gperftools header locations if available.
-// If not, fall back to the old (gperftools < 2.0) locations.
-
-#include <gperftools/heap-profiler.h>
-#include <gperftools/malloc_extension.h>
-
-#include "heap_profiler.h"
-#include "common/environment.h"
-#include "common/LogClient.h"
-#include "global/global_context.h"
-#include "common/debug.h"
-
-#define dout_context g_ceph_context
-
-bool ceph_using_tcmalloc()
-{
-  return true;
-}
-
-void ceph_heap_profiler_init()
-{
-  // Two other interesting environment variables to set are:
-  // HEAP_PROFILE_ALLOCATION_INTERVAL, HEAP_PROFILE_INUSE_INTERVAL
-  if (get_env_bool("CEPH_HEAP_PROFILER_INIT")) {
-    ceph_heap_profiler_start();
-  }
-}
-
-void ceph_heap_profiler_stats(char *buf, int length)
-{
-  MallocExtension::instance()->GetStats(buf, length);
-}
-
-void ceph_heap_release_free_memory()
-{
-  MallocExtension::instance()->ReleaseFreeMemory();
-}
-
-bool ceph_heap_get_numeric_property(
-  const char *property, size_t *value)
-{
-  return MallocExtension::instance()->GetNumericProperty(
-    property,
-    value);
-}
-
-bool ceph_heap_set_numeric_property(
-  const char *property, size_t value)
-{
-  return MallocExtension::instance()->SetNumericProperty(
-    property,
-    value);
-}
-
-bool ceph_heap_profiler_running()
-{
-#ifdef HAVE_LIBTCMALLOC
-  return IsHeapProfilerRunning();
-#else
-  return false;
-#endif
-}
-
-static void get_profile_name(char *profile_name, int profile_name_len)
-{
-  char path[PATH_MAX];
-  snprintf(path, sizeof(path), "%s", g_conf->log_file.c_str());
-  char *last_slash = rindex(path, '/');
-
-  if (last_slash == NULL) {
-    snprintf(profile_name, profile_name_len, "./%s.profile",
-            g_conf->name.to_cstr());
-  }
-  else {
-    last_slash[1] = '\0';
-    snprintf(profile_name, profile_name_len, "%s/%s.profile",
-            path, g_conf->name.to_cstr());
-  }
-}
-
-void ceph_heap_profiler_start()
-{
-#ifdef HAVE_LIBTCMALLOC
-  char profile_name[PATH_MAX];
-  get_profile_name(profile_name, sizeof(profile_name)); 
-  generic_dout(0) << "turning on heap profiler with prefix "
-                 << profile_name << dendl;
-  HeapProfilerStart(profile_name);
-#endif
-}
-
-void ceph_heap_profiler_stop()
-{
-#ifdef HAVE_LIBTCMALLOC
-  HeapProfilerStop();
-#endif
-}
-
-void ceph_heap_profiler_dump(const char *reason)
-{
-#ifdef HAVE_LIBTCMALLOC
-  HeapProfilerDump(reason);
-#endif
-}
-
-#define HEAP_PROFILER_STATS_SIZE 2048
-
-void ceph_heap_profiler_handle_command(const std::vector<std::string>& cmd,
-                                       ostream& out)
-{
-#ifdef HAVE_LIBTCMALLOC
-  if (cmd.size() == 1 && cmd[0] == "dump") {
-    if (!ceph_heap_profiler_running()) {
-      out << "heap profiler not running; can't dump";
-      return;
-    }
-    char heap_stats[HEAP_PROFILER_STATS_SIZE];
-    ceph_heap_profiler_stats(heap_stats, sizeof(heap_stats));
-    out << g_conf->name << " dumping heap profile now.\n"
-       << heap_stats;
-    ceph_heap_profiler_dump("admin request");
-  } else if (cmd.size() == 1 && cmd[0] == "start_profiler") {
-    ceph_heap_profiler_start();
-    out << g_conf->name << " started profiler";
-  } else if (cmd.size() == 1 && cmd[0] == "stop_profiler") {
-    ceph_heap_profiler_stop();
-    out << g_conf->name << " stopped profiler";
-  } else if (cmd.size() == 1 && cmd[0] == "release") {
-    ceph_heap_release_free_memory();
-    out << g_conf->name << " releasing free RAM back to system.";
-  } else
-#endif
-  if (cmd.size() == 1 && cmd[0] == "stats") {
-    char heap_stats[HEAP_PROFILER_STATS_SIZE];
-    ceph_heap_profiler_stats(heap_stats, sizeof(heap_stats));
-    out << g_conf->name << " tcmalloc heap stats:"
-       << heap_stats;
-  } else {
-    out << "unknown command " << cmd;
-  }
-}
